Micah Lasher, experienced lawmaker with close ties to Jewish community, wins race to replace Nadler
Micah Lasher, a Jewish Democrat, has won the primary election for a House seat in Manhattan, capturing 39% of the votes with most counted. His victory is significant as it reflects his strong ties to the Jewish community and marks a transition in leadership for the area previously held by Jerry Nadler.
Lasher's campaign highlights his experience and connections within the Jewish community, making him a prominent figure for issues important to Israel and Jewish Americans. The election results are part of a larger political landscape influencing Jewish representation in U.S. Congress.
